DNA (DNA) is a crypto asset listed by major public crypto data trackers as a Solana ecosystem token in the Meme and DeSci Meme categories. The project presents the DNA Solana token around the idea of genetics, evolution, and community culture, using the familiar “DNA” concept as a simple identity for social sharing and market discussion. Rather than being described as a complex application token, DNA is primarily positioned as a community-driven cultural asset whose visibility depends on holder participation, online attention, and broader appetite for high-volatility thematic tokens. DNA (DNA) works as a token in the Solana ecosystem, where transfers, wallet balances, and market activity are recorded on-chain through Solana-compatible infrastructure. The DNA Solana token does not appear to be documented as a governance token for a large protocol or as a claim on protocol revenue. Its practical mechanism is closer to a social token model: users hold, transfer, track, and discuss DNA while the project identity is shaped by community coordination, memes, and market visibility. Because public data pages identify DNA with very large token supply figures, users often analyze it through unit price, market capitalization, fully diluted valuation, and liquidity rather than through per-token scarcity alone. In this model, attention and distribution are important. If more users watch the DNA price, search for DNA token data, or participate in community channels, the token may become more visible; if attention falls, liquidity and demand can weaken quickly. This makes risk management especially important when interpreting DNA market movement.

The value of DNA (DNA) is influenced by ecosystem growth, adoption, utility signals, market demand, and narrative-specific factors. For a DNA Solana token with meme positioning, price behavior can be highly sensitive to attention cycles, liquidity changes, holder confidence, and broader risk appetite across crypto markets.
Community Growth matters because DNA’s public identity depends heavily on how many users recognize, discuss, and track the token. A larger holder and follower base can improve awareness of the DNA Solana token, support more consistent market discussion, and create stronger feedback loops around watchlists, charts, and community content. Weak community activity can reduce visibility and lower demand.
Social Media Attention can influence DNA because meme-sector tokens often rely on fast-moving online narratives. Posts, community campaigns, chart discussions, and genetics-themed content can increase search demand for DNA price information and attract short-term market interest. However, social attention can fade quickly, so users should separate temporary visibility from sustained adoption.
Market Speculation is a major driver for DNA because the token is not primarily valued through documented protocol cash flows or utility fees. Traders may respond to chart momentum, supply optics, market capitalization, and narrative rotation. Speculative demand can increase trading activity, but it can also make DNA more volatile when momentum slows or sentiment changes.
Exchange Listings matter because easier market access can improve discoverability, liquidity, and price transparency. For users following DNA on KCEX, listing-related visibility may help more traders find the token and compare its market data. Still, a listing by itself does not guarantee durable demand; sustained activity depends on community interest, liquidity depth, and continued market relevance.
Risk Appetite affects DNA because small-cap meme assets typically perform better when traders are willing to take on higher volatility. In risk-on periods, users may search for emerging Solana meme tokens and rotate into speculative assets. In risk-off markets, liquidity may move toward larger assets, reducing demand for tokens like DNA and increasing downside sensitivity.
Solana Meme Token Positioning is a coin-specific factor because DNA is tracked as part of the Solana ecosystem. Solana’s low-cost, high-activity retail environment can make it easier for communities to create and circulate token narratives. If Solana meme activity strengthens, the DNA Solana token may benefit from increased category-level attention and broader ecosystem searches.
High-Supply Tokenomics is important for DNA because public data trackers show an extremely large maximum supply. This affects how users interpret unit price, market capitalization, and fully diluted valuation. A low unit price can attract attention, but market value depends on total supply, circulating supply, liquidity, and demand. Understanding DNA tokenomics helps users avoid judging price by decimals alone.
